“The traffic is definitely a mess here, It’s faster to walk than to drive as per the traffic in the video. the directions came with a warning, “Start early to factor in traffic delays.” Nobody wants to get stuck in the traffice.Reports say an average citizen spends more than 240 hours stuck in jams every year and Sreehari estimates that traffic delays cost the city $950 million a year. The reason for this is because of unplanned- growth of the city,Bengaluru is often described as the Silicon Valley of India as it is home to the IT industry. So most people are dependent on private transport. Sreehari says the city has 6.6 million private vehicles, including one million cars. “We have only 6,500-7,000 public buses to carry 45% of the city’s traffic. The Metro construction has been very slow.
